Ladies, have a question about flowers- I received my planning packet yesterday (woohoo) and they want me to put down a specific style number - but while I like the style I do not want those colors. I've included photos of the colors I like...do you think that is enough for them to get the idea?

 

Specifically for centerpieces I like the container in one but the flowers in the other, I am so nervous this will become lost in translation!

 

I found that they did a really good job with the flowers.  I suggest being SUPER specific on the 2 month form because it sounds like a lot of girls have had problems before me.  I included photos of exactly what I wanted and acceptable alternative flowers in case the ones I wanted weren't in season.  I also forbid certain flowers like babies breath and daisies that I didn't want at the wedding. 

 

These are the photos I included on my 2 month form that I found on the internet, and you can see above what I ended up with:

bridesmaid bouquet?

 

bridesmaid bouquet option

(For the BM bouquet I requested spider mums as an alternative to the greenery found in these and more purple--I thought they really delivered!)

 

If all else fails or you have second thoughts, the wedding coordinator double checks everything at your initial appointment.  You can always bring more photos or specifics at that time.  :)

yours came out beautifully- what are the white flowers in your bridesmaid bouquet? I am not as concerned with the flower type as I want primarily roses (though I put no lilies...will probably say no gerber daisy too) I am more concerned with color as I want very light blushes, ivory etc. and am afraid with it being Mexico it will be a little too vibrant for my style.

I think it was a type of rose, but I'm not 100% sure.  Those would definitely be pretty as a blush/ivory bouquet!  The other bride who was there during my stay had the same color scheme, so I think they can tone it down if that's what you're wanting.  Feel free to use the picture in your 2 month form and tell them that's what you want. :)
